Is the Paralegal Training Accredited? The paralegal school and program that you enroll in need to be accredited by a recognized organization such as the American Bar Association. If it is an online program, it can also receive accreditation from the Distance Education and Training Council, which focuses on online or distance education. Accreditation will not only certify that the education you will obtain will be of the highest quality, but it will show potential employers that you are a qualified professional also. A number of Kirkland WA law firms will only employ entry level legal assistants that have graduated from an accredited program. Finally, financial assistance and student loans are typically obtainable only for accredited schools.

Does the Program Provide Internships? Internship programs offer students an opportunity to experience working in a law office or other legal enterprise while still in school. They can also offer a means for students to start establishing contacts within the Kirkland WA legal field. Ask if the paralegal programs you are considering offer internship programs, specifically in areas of the law that you are most interested in pursuing after graduation.

Is Job Placement Help offered? You will undoubtedly wish to secure employment quickly after graduation, but getting that initial job in a new field can be difficult without help. Ask if the paralegal programs you are assessing have job placement programs and what their placement rates are. Rapid and high placement rates are a good sign that the schools have substantial networks and good relationships with Washington legal services employers. It also confirms that their graduates are well regarded and sought after.

What is the Entire Cost? Paralegal schools can differ in cost based on the credential obtained and the amount of training furnished. However, tuition will not be the only cost for your training. Remember to add the cost of books, supplies and commuting to classes to your budget also. Financial aid may be available to help minimize some of the expense, so be sure to contact the school's financial aid department to find out what is available in Kirkland WA. Needless to say that if you decide to attend an online school, some of these additional expenses, for instance for commuting, might be reduced or eliminated.

Do the Classes Accommodate your Schedule? Many paralegal students continue working while receiving their training and must have flexibility in class scheduling. If you can solely attend night or weekend classes near Kirkland WA, make sure classes are offered at those times. Also, if you can only attend on a part time basis, make certain that the school you choose provides that option. Last, find out what the protocol is for making up classes missed as a result of work, illness or family emergencies.
